Things to Consider Before Using Work Office
Before deciding to use Work Office, there are a few things to keep in mind:
- License Type: Make sure you understand the licensing terms for the font. Some fonts require a commercial license if you plan to use them for business purposes.
- Compatibility: Check that the font works well with your design software or platform. Some fonts may not render correctly on all devices or programs.
- Readability: While Work Office is elegant, it’s important to ensure that it remains readable in different sizes and formats. Avoid using it for long blocks of text where legibility is crucial.
- Design Balance: Pair Work Office with other fonts that complement its style. Using it as a headline font with a simpler body font can create a balanced and professional look.
By considering these factors, you can ensure that Work Office enhances your projects without causing any issues with readability or usability.
